THE Department of Transport visited 15 schools in the uMfolozi Municipality district to hand over 750 bicycles to deserving learners.
Each school received 50 bicycles.
Deputy Minister of Transport, Sindisiwe Chikunga, said the initiative is aimed at improving mobility for learners from rural and remote communities.
uMfolozi Mayor Smangaliso Mgenge reminded the community that the bicycles are strictly for the use by the learners and not for anyone else.
